40 Roller Track Placon Mount drop High
Roller track placon mount work as a connector for roller track and pipe or aluminum profile in rack syetem, it is a necessary parts in rack system which widely used in industrial plant and logistic,warehouse storage.

The "How": Step-by-Step to Upgrading Your System

Okay, so you're sold on the idea. Now what? Upgrading with the 40 Roller Track Placon Mount drop High isn't rocket science, but it does require some planning. Let's walk through the process, from assessing your needs to flipping the "start" switch on your newly upgraded line.

Step 1: Audit Your Current Setup

Grab a notebook (or your phone—we won't judge) and walk your production line. Ask: Where are the bottlenecks? Is there a section where parts frequently get stuck? Are workers bending or reaching awkwardly to load/unload items from the roller track? Measure the height of your existing workbenches, conveyors, and material racks. The 40 Roller Track Placon Mount drop High is adjustable, but knowing your current dimensions will help you decide how much "drop" you need (the "drop high" refers to the vertical distance it can lower from the mounting profile).

For example, if your current roller track is 36 inches high but workers are struggling to reach it, dropping it to 32 inches might cut down on fatigue and errors. Jot down these measurements—they'll be crucial when ordering the right placon mount brackets.

Step 2: Gather Your Tools (Spoiler: You Won't Need a Wrench Army)

One of the perks of lean system upgrades is that they're designed for the average maintenance team, not just certified engineers. For this install, you'll need:

  • A tape measure (for double-checking those heights you noted)
  • An Allen wrench set (most placon mount brackets use hex screws)
  • A rubber mallet (for gently tapping the track into place—no brute force needed)
  • A level (to make sure the track is straight; even a tiny slope can cause parts to stick)
  • Optional: A friend to help hold the track while you secure it (teamwork makes the dream work, right?)

Step 3: Install and Adjust (It's Easier Than Ikea Furniture)

Now for the fun part. Start by removing the old roller track (if you're replacing it) or clearing space for the new one. Align the placon mount brackets with your aluminum profile—they should slide into the T-slot easily. Once they're in position, tighten the screws with the Allen wrench—snug, but not so tight that you strip the threads. Then, attach the 40 Roller Track to the brackets. Most models come with pre-drilled holes, so it's just a matter of lining them up and securing with screws.

Here's where the "drop high" shines: if you need to adjust the height, simply loosen the bracket screws, slide the track up or down to your desired height, and retighten. Use the level to ensure it's straight, then give it a test run. Roll a few sample parts down the track—they should glide smoothly, no sticking or jamming. If something feels off, check the alignment again or adjust the wheel tension (some models have small screws to tweak wheel tightness).
